How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Odd?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Odd Studio Apartments | $1,445 | $790 | $1,996 |
Odd 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,255 | $600 | $2,732 |
Odd 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,054 | $500 | $3,039 |
Odd 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,072 | $420 | $2,835 |
Odd 4 Bedroom Apartments | $833 | $410 | $2,799 |
